			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://steventoth.net/blog/wp-content/uploads/2009/01/v200-b1-ui.png" ><img class="alignleft size-thumbnail wp-image-228" title="v200-b1-ui" src="http://steventoth.net/blog/wp-content/uploads/2009/01/v200-b1-ui-150x150.png" alt="" width="150" height="150" /></a>If you&#8217;re not interested in crusty old command line application, and you want a familiar Mac OS GUI then you&#8217;re in for a treat. The 2.0.0 beta has been released. Download it from <a href="http://www.steventoth.net/hdpvrcapture/HDPVRCapture-v2.0.0-b1.zip" onclick="javascript:pageTracker._trackPageview('/downloads/hdpvrcapture/HDPVRCapture-v2.0.0-b1.zip');">here</a>. What&#8217;s new? Well, a lot has changed.</p>
<p>Major improvements:</p>
<ul>
<li>A brand new graphical UI with simple point and click options.</li>
<li>Support for scheduling via TitanTV. Go to Titan&#8217;s site, click on a show, the tvpi file will download. Click on this file and it should automatically open with HDPVRCapture, confirm the details and it gets added to your iCal. Voila! Scheduled recordings, very simple.</li>
<li>You don&#8217;t use titan? Try Command-N to manually add a scheduled recording</li>
<li>Use your zipcode to help configure HDPVRCapture, this will download the cable/satellite networks for your area, and automatically store the channel names in HDPVRCapture, so you can pick you recording channel by name, not by number. Now you don&#8217;t have to remember that scifi is on channel 48, just select SCIFI-HD from the channel selection list.</li>
<li>The Preference page let&#8217;s you enter you license key, configure Titan _AND_ has a radically new IR Blaster configuration screen. No more complicated command line options.</li>
<li>Drag and drop your previous recordings into the post processing tab, right click and chose a post processing task and chose Run from the menu. I.E Simplified post processing with support for automatic addition to itunes.</li>
<li>Intelligent controls in the UI. If you select a feature that is incompatible with another feature, the application automatically adjusts itself. No more complicated command line options which are hard to understand.</li>
</ul>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ong>Background: In terms of the HDPVR, if your output filename ends in either .ts or .m2ts the recording contains exactly the same video/audio content, it&#8217;s only a difference in the filename extension. </strong>Why? To ensure better support in other applications.</p>
<p>A number of people have emailed and asked me how to stream .ts and .m2ts recordings via UPnP to a PS3 for playback. I use the excellent MediaTomb [<a href="http://mediatomb.cc/" onclick="javascript:pageTracker._trackPageview('/outbound/article/mediatomb.cc');">link</a>] application, which happens to be OpenSource and customizable. Why burn recordings to disk just to play them back, right?</p>
<p>Part of the problem with the MediaTomb is that it&#8217;s default configuration file ($HOME/.mediatomb/config.xml) is not going to work properly with the PS3, or the HDPVR. So, here&#8217;s the configuration file that I use [<a href="http://www.steventoth.net/hdpvrcapture/mediatomb.config.xml" >link</a>] and it&#8217;s working pretty reliably for me.</p>
<p>Right click and download this file, rename to config.xml and install this into your environment, overwriting your current configuration file. In my case:</p>
<p><span style="font-family: 'Courier New'; line-height: 18px; white-space: pre;">mv mediatomb.config.xml $HOME/.mediatomb/config.xml</span></p>
<p>Restart MediaTomb then enjoy!</p>
